Making Salts and the Reactivity Series

Salts can be produced through various chemical reactions involving acids. For example, copper chloride is made by reacting hydrochloric acid with copper oxide:

CuO + 2HCl → CuCl₂ + H₂O

The process involves:

  1. Warming the dilute acid
  2. Adding the insoluble base until excess remains
  3. Filtering out excess solid
  4. Evaporating the solution to form crystals

Highlight: The reactivity series lists metals in order of their reactivity towards other substances, based on how easily they lose electrons to form positive ions.

Metals react with acids to form salts and hydrogen gas:

Acid + Metal → Salt + Hydrogen

Example: Magnesium reacts with hydrochloric acid to form magnesium chloride and hydrogen gas: Mg + 2HCl → MgCl₂ + H₂

The speed of the reaction indicates the metal's reactivity:

  • More reactive metals like potassium and sodium react explosively
  • Less reactive metals like magnesium and zinc react less violently
  • Copper generally doesn't react with cold, dilute acids

Vocabulary: Redox reactions involve the transfer of electrons, where oxidation is the loss of electrons and reduction is the gain of electrons.

Redox Reactions and Further Concepts

Redox reactions play a crucial role in understanding chemical changes involving acids, bases, and metals. These reactions involve the transfer of electrons between species:

  • Oxidation: Loss of electrons
  • Reduction: Gain of electrons

Definition: A redox reaction occurs when one species is oxidized and another is reduced simultaneously.

The reactivity series of metals provides insight into how readily different metals undergo redox reactions:

  1. Potassium
  2. Sodium
  3. Calcium
  4. Magnesium ...

Highlight: The more reactive a metal is, the more easily it loses electrons and reacts with other substances like water or acids.

Investigating metal reactivity can be done by measuring temperature changes during reactions. In a fair experiment, more reactive metals should produce greater temperature increases.

Example: Comparing the temperature change when magnesium and zinc react with hydrochloric acid can indicate their relative reactivity.

Metals also react with water, with more reactive metals producing more vigorous reactions. This behavior correlates with their position in the reactivity series.

Vocabulary: Effervescence is the production of bubbles during a chemical reaction, often seen when metals react with acids to produce hydrogen gas.

Chemical Changes: Acids and Bases

The pH scale is a fundamental concept in chemistry, measuring the acidity or alkalinity of solutions. It ranges from 0 to 14, with lower values indicating higher acidity and higher values indicating greater alkalinity.

Definition: The pH scale measures the concentration of hydrogen ions in a solution, determining its acidity or alkalinity.

Acids and bases are defined by their behavior on the pH scale:

  • Acids have a pH less than 7 and form H+ ions in water.
  • Bases have a pH greater than 7 and can neutralize acids.
  • Alkalis are bases that dissolve in water, forming OH- ions.

Highlight: Neutralization occurs when acids and bases react, forming salt and water.

The strength of acids is determined by their ionization in water:

  • Strong acids completely ionize in water.
  • Weak acids only partially ionize in water.

Example: Hydrochloric acid (HCl) is a strong acid, while acetic acid (CH₃COOH) is a weak acid.

Titration is a crucial process in acid-base chemistry:

  1. It determines the exact amount of acid needed to neutralize an alkali (or vice versa).
  2. This data is used to calculate acid or alkali concentration.

Vocabulary: Phenolphthalein is an indicator used in titrations, turning pink in alkaline conditions and colorless in neutral or acidic conditions.

Acids react with various substances:

  • Metal oxides and hydroxides (alkalis) react with acids to form salt and water.
  • Metal carbonates react with acids to produce salt, water, and carbon dioxide.
